The Rolling Stones - Stones in Exile

Stones in Exile

Last night, members of the Wines That Rock crew were in attendance at New York's Museum of Modern Art for the Premier of ‘Stones In Exile’

Mick Jagger, Keith Richards and Charlie Watts were there to open the evening and introduce the film, which was shown in its entirety to a star studded audience. There was a fun reception afterwards, which they attended as well.

Stones In Exile

The film documents the Rolling Stones around 1971 as they are 'exiled' from the UK and take up residence in France. Keith Richards took up residence at a villa called Nellcôte in Villefranche-sur-Mer, which becomes the studio, living quarters and amazing Rolling Stones headquarters for the recording of band’s masterpiece “Exile On Main Street”.

The movie “Stones In Exile” tells the inside story of making the music in the band’s own words.  Great movie. Stones Fan or not, make it your business to see this one. It reminded me of why I’m a Rolling Stones fan and really made me want to go home and break out the album.  A rare glimpse into elements that make up the Rolling Stones mythos.  Someone at the event commented that this film should be required viewing for all.
